Comprehending the King Shepherd Breed:

Before diving into the purchasing procedure, it's important to comprehend what a King Shepherd really is. Developed in the 1990s in the United States by breeders Shelley Watts-Cross and David Turkheimer, the King Shepherd was created with the vision of producing a bigger, healthier, and more stable variation of the German Shepherd Dog. They accomplished this by thoroughly crossing German Shepherds with Shiloh Shepherds and other breeds, leading to a dog that embodies desirable characteristics from its origins.

King Shepherds are known for their:

  • Impressive Size: Significantly bigger than German Shepherds, males can withstand 30 inches high and weigh between 90-150 pounds, while women are slightly smaller sized.
  • Striking Appearance: They have a wolf-like look with a stunning gait. Their coat is generally luxurious and medium-long, offered in various colors comparable to German Shepherds.
  • Mild and Affectionate Temperament: Despite their enforcing size, King Shepherds are known for being mild, devoted, and affectionate with their households. They are frequently good with kids and other family pets when properly interacted socially.
  • Intelligence and Trainability: Bred from intelligent working types, King Shepherds are extremely trainable and excited to please, making them master various canine activities.
  • Lower Drive Than Some Working Breeds: Compared to German Shepherds, they may have a slightly lower prey drive and energy level, though they still need routine workout.

Finding a Reputable King Shepherd Breeder: Your First and Most Crucial Step

When considering buying a King Shepherd, discovering a respectable breeder is vital. This is not simply about getting a puppy; it's about guaranteeing you're getting a healthy, well-tempered dog that comes from ethical and accountable breeding practices. Avoid puppy mills, family pet stores, and yard breeders at all expenses, as these sources frequently focus on revenue over the wellness of the pets.

Red Flags to Avoid in Breeders:

  • Multiple Breeds: Breeders concentrating on many different types are unlikely to be professionals in any one.
  • No Health Testing: Reputable breeders will carry out extensive health testing on their reproducing dogs to reduce the risk of handing down hereditary conditions.
  • Lack of Transparency: Be careful if a breeder hesitates to reveal you their centers, parent dogs, or Schäferhund kaufen öSterreich provide referrals.
  • Objection to Answer Questions: An excellent breeder will more than happy to answer your concerns and ask you concerns to guarantee you're an appropriate home for their puppy.
  • Pressure to Buy Quickly: Ethical breeders prioritize discovering the ideal homes for their puppies and will not push you into a fast choice.
  • Online Marketplace Sales: Reputable breeders hardly ever sell puppies through online markets or classified ads.

Qualities of a Reputable King Shepherd Breeder:

  • Breed Specific Focus: They focus on King Shepherds and are educated about the type's standards, character, and health issues.
  • Health Testing and Transparency: They can supply evidence of health clearances for hips, elbows, hearts, and other pertinent conditions for their breeding dogs.
  • Clean and Healthy Environment: Their centers are clean, spacious, and offer a revitalizing environment for the dogs.
  • Socializing and Early Care: They prioritize early socialization for puppies, exposing them to various sights, sounds, and people.
  • Matching Puppies to Homes: They make the effort to comprehend your way of life and choices to match you with a puppy that is a good fit for your family.
  • Lifetime Support: They provide continuous support and guidance to puppy purchasers throughout the dog's life.
  • Agreement and Health Guarantee: They provide a composed contract and health guarantee for their puppies.

Prospective Health Concerns in King Shepherds:

While King Shepherds are generally healthier than German Shepherds, they are still susceptible to particular health conditions:

  • Hip and Elbow Dysplasia: Common in large types, these conditions involve unusual advancement of the hip and elbow joints. Respectable breeders screen their canines for these concerns.
  • Degenerative Myelopathy (DM): A progressive neurological disease affecting the spine.
  • Bloat (Gastric Dilatation-Volvulus): A life-threatening condition that can happen in deep-chested types.
  • Panosteitis: Growing pains that can impact young, quickly growing canines.

Working with a trustworthy breeder who focuses on health screening substantially decreases the threat of these conditions.

The Cost of Owning a King Shepherd:

The monetary commitment of owning a King Shepherd extends beyond the preliminary purchase rate. Consider these expenses:

  • Puppy Price: From reliable breeders, King Shepherd puppies can range from ₤ 2,000 to ₤ 5,000 or more, depending on lineage, breeder track record, and area.
  • Preliminary Supplies: Crate, bed, food bowls, leash, collar, toys, grooming supplies can easily total up to numerous hundred dollars.
  • Food: Large type pet dogs consume a substantial quantity of food. Premium dog food can cost ₤ 50 - ₤ 100+ per month.
  • Veterinary Care: Routine check-ups, vaccinations, parasite prevention, and potential unforeseen vet costs can be considerable. Spending plan at least ₤ 500 - ₤ 1000+ annually.
  • Grooming: Professional grooming services, if preferred, can contribute to the expense.
  • Training: Obedience classes or personal training sessions will be useful.
  • Miscellaneous: Toys, treats, bedding replacements, and emergency situation funds need to likewise be factored in.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s) about Buying a King Shepherd:

Q: How much does a King Shepherd puppy expense?A: From reputable breeders, King Shepherd puppies generally vary from ₤ 2,000 to ₤ 5,000 or more. Cost can differ based upon family tree, breeder credibility, area, and coat color.

Q: Are King Shepherds excellent with kids?A: Yes, King Shepherds are normally understood to be good with kids, especially when raised with them from puppyhood. Their mild and patient nature makes them wonderful household canines. Nevertheless, similar to any type, guidance is always recommended, particularly with young kids.

Q: Do King Shepherds shed a lot?A: Yes, King Shepherds are moderate to heavy shedders, specifically throughout shedding seasons (spring and fall). Regular brushing is important to handle shedding and keep their coat healthy.

Q: How much workout do King Shepherds require?A: King Shepherds need moderate everyday exercise, around 60-90 minutes. This can consist of walks, runs, playtime, and mental stimulation activities.

Q: Are King Shepherds simple to train?A: Yes, King Shepherds are extremely smart and excited to please, making them normally simple to train. Positive reinforcement techniques work best with this breed. Early socialization and consistent training are crucial.

Q: What are some common health issues in King Shepherds?A: While typically much healthier than German Shepherds, King Shepherds can be vulnerable to hip and elbow dysplasia, degenerative myelopathy, bloat, and panosteitis. Selecting a reliable breeder who health tests their dogs minimizes these threats.

Q: Are King Shepherds good watchdog?A: Yes, their size, protective impulses, German Shepherd protective instinct and commitment make them effective deterrents. They are naturally protective of their households but are not generally aggressive without factor.
